Supported Data Formats¶
Cross-sections¶
Supported formats are:
.pickleTauREx2 pickle format.hdf5,.h5New HDF5 format.dat, ExoTransmit format
More formats can be included through Plugins
Tip
For opacities we recommend using hi-res cross-sections (R>7000) from a high temperature linelist. Our recommendation are linelists from the ExoMol project.
K-Tables¶
Added in version 3.1.
Supported formats are:
.pickleTauREx2 pickle format.hdf5,.h5petitRADTRANS HDF5 format.kta, NEMESIS format
More formats can be included through Plugins

Cloud Grid Files¶
The built-in PyMieScattGridExtinction contribution reads precomputed cloud
grids from HDF5 files. Each file must contain:
radius_gridwith particle radii in micronswavenumber_gridin \(cm^{-1}\)QextorQext_gridwith shape(n_radius, n_wavenumber)
These files are external science data products rather than TauREx-native output files, but they can now be used directly without installing a separate plugin.
Collisionally Induced Absorption¶
Only a few formats are supported
.dbTauREx2 CIA pickle files.ciaHITRAN cia files
